Node.js是一个开源且跨平台的JavaScript运行时环境,它允许开发者在服务器端运行JavaScript代码。下面是在Windows、CentOS和Ubuntu上安装Node.js的详细教程。
一、Windows上安装Node.js
-
下载安装包:
- 访问Node.js官网。
- 选择适合Windows的版本(通常有LTS(长期支持)和最新版本)。
- 下载
.msi
安装程序(32位或64位,取决于你的系统)。
-
安装过程:
- 双击下载的
.msi
文件开始安装。 - 遵循安装向导的指示完成安装。
- 在安装过程中,确保勾选了"Add to PATH"选项,这样你就可以在命令行中直接访问Node.js和npm。
- 双击下载的
-
验证安装:
- 打开命令提示符或PowerShell。
- 输入
node -v
和npm -v
来分别检查Node.js和npm的版本,确保它们已正确安装。
二、CentOS上安装Node.js
1. 添加Node.js仓库:
-
- 打开终端。
- 你可以通过执行curl命令来添加NodeSource仓库,例如对于Node.js 14.x,使用:
bash
curl -sL https://rpm.nodesource.com/setup_14.x | sudo bash -
2. 安装Node.js:
- 安装Node.js及npm:
bash
sudo yum install -y nodejs
3.验证安装:
bash
node -v
npm -v
三、Ubuntu上安装Node.js
1、添加Node.js PPA:
- 打开终端。
- 你可以通过添加NodeSource PPA来安装最新版本的Node.js。例如,对于Node.js 14.x,使用:
bash
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-
2、安装Node.js:
- 安装Node.js及npm:
bash
sudo apt-get install -y nodejs
3、验证安装:
- 检查Node.js和npm的版本:
bash
node -v
npm -v
四、注意事项
- 版本选择:根据你的需求选择Node.js的版本。LTS版本更稳定,适合生产环境,而最新版本包含了最新的功能。